NYSE Floor Brokers Get New Handhelds

FRONT PAGE: EXCHANGE TECHNOLOGIES

NEW YORK—DWT has learned that IBM and Micro Design Services (MDS) have partnered to create a new, wireless handheld device for the floor brokers of the New York Stock Exchange (NYSE).

So far, only a handful of the handheld devices—commonly designed for trading purposes—have been distributed to the floor of the Big Board.

"It's the seventh generation of handhelds in seven years, and we've continually expanded the product to increase functionality and enhance usability," says a NYSE spokesperson.
